AI Summary
-
Amends the Federal Lands Recreation Enhancement Act to provide free annual National Parks and Federal Recreational Lands Passes to law enforcement officers and firefighters, in addition to the existing benefit for Armed Forces members and their dependents
-
Defines "firefighter" as any federal, state, local, or Indian Tribe employee who performs work directly related to suppressing fires, including wildland fires
-
Defines "law enforcement officer" as any federal, state, local, or Indian Tribe officer, agent, or employee authorized to engage in or supervise crime prevention, detection, investigation, or supervision of sentenced criminal offenders
-
Requires eligible individuals to provide adequate proof of eligibility as determined by the Secretary to receive the free pass
-
Passed the House of Representatives on July 21, 2025
